web8

第八章 ASP 存取数据库 8.1 ASP与数据库 各种存取数据方法的比较 cookie: 优点:纪录浏览者的信息并决定cookie的生命周期。存放在客户端,不会占用服务器端的空间。 缺点: 浏览者可能禁止服务端写入。 只能记录串、数值、日期等简单数据。 可能被浏览者删除。 可能导致个人信息丢失 Application 变量 优点:可以记录整个网站的信息 缺点:若服务器关机或重启, Application 对象记录的任何变量都将恢复为empty。 Session 变量 优点:可以记录个别浏览器端的信息 缺点:若浏览者20分钟没有访问网页,session对象记录的任何变量都将恢复为empty。 数据库 优点:适合记录大量数据,可以进行读取、插入、删除、更新与查询。 缺点:虽然数据库的查询速度快,但打开数据库连接需花费较多时间。 8.2 ADO(Active Data Objects) ASP是通过一组统称为ADO(Active Data Objects)的对象模块来访问数据库的。 无论采用什么数据库:Access、SQL server、VFP、Oracle、dBase或其他,只要对应数据库具有对应的ODBC或OLEDB驱动程序,ADO对象就可以访问。 只要有IIS,系统至少会有Access、SQL、Oracle的驱动。 ADO 对象模块的结构 Connection对象:打

文档评论(0)

1亿VIP精品文档

相关文档